ATTO 665 is a new fluorescent label related to ATTO 647N.

Optical properties

  • λ abs = 662nm
  • ε max = 1.60×105 M -1 cm -1
  • λ fl = 680 nm
  • n fl = 60 %
  • τ fl = 2.9 ns
  • CF 260 = ε 260max = 0.07
  • CF 280 = ε 280 / ε max = 0.06

ATTO 665 is a new fluorescent label related to ATTO 647N.

Characteristic features of the label are strong absorption, extraordinarily high fluorescence quantum yield, high thermal and photo-stability, and exceptionally high stability towards atmospheric ozone. In common with most ATTO-TEC-labels, absorption and fluorescence are independent of pH, at least in the range of pH 2 to 11, used in typical applications.

ATTO 665 is a cationic dye. After coupling to a substrate the dye carries a net electrical charge of +1. ATTO 665 is a hydrophobic dye. The fluorescence is excited most efficiently in the range 640 - 675 nm. A suitable excitation source is the 647 nm line of the Krypton-Ion laser or a diode-laser emitting at 650 nm.
